I chose to make curtain panels out of Temptrol, utilizing small tension rods to easily set them into my windows during the summer and remove them for the winter.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003ccenter\u003e\u003cimg height=\"159\" width=\"300\" alt=\"black curtains with insulation sewn into them\" src=\"https:\/\/www.barnworld.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/02\/black-curtains-e1708119244606.jpg\"\u003e\u003c\/center\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eWhat impressed me most about Temptrol is its ease of use. Whether sewing by hand or using a machine, this fabric is incredibly easy to work with. It cuts smoothly and cleanly without leaving residue, making the sewing process hassle-free.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eI strategically stitched Temptrol to the window-facing side of my blackout curtains, leaving some sections unlined for flexibility. This setup effectively keeps the heat in during winter by directing the reflective side toward the bedroom. In summer, removable Temptrol panels placed against the glass behind Venetian blinds with the reflective side facing out significantly reduce heat transfer, especially in rooms furthest from the HVAC system.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003ccenter\u003e\u003cimg height='211\"' width=\"300\" alt=\"kitchen blinds with Temptrol Insulation\" src=\"https:\/\/www.barnworld.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/02\/window-blinds-2-e1708119388270.jpg\"\u003e\u003c\/center\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eBefore using Temptrol, the south-facing windows in my home turned the surrounding area into a furnace during summer afternoons. However, after installing the panels, the walls remained cool to the touch all day long, and the comfort level in that area improved drastically. Not only did Temptrol prevent radiant heat from entering the building materials, but it also reflected it out, creating a more comfortable environment indoors.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003ccenter\u003e\u003cimg height=\"368\" width=\"350\" alt=\"temprol with curatins\" src=\"https:\/\/www.barnworld.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/02\/used-in-curtains-3-e1708119497550.jpg\"\u003e\u003c\/center\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eAside from its effectiveness in insulation, I appreciate the versatility of Temptrol for various DIY projects. Be sure to check out all of our \u003ca href=\"https:\/\/www.barnworld.com\/livestock-supplies\/?cat_link=Barn_Building_Insulation\"\u003einsulation products here\u003c\/a\u003e!\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003ch2\u003e\u003cb\u003eAn Introduction to Radiant Barrier Foil Insulation\u003c\/b\u003e\u003c\/h2\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eUnderstanding how a thin sheet of reflective material, reminiscent of kitchen foil, can significantly impact heat transfer might seem challenging at first glance. However, that's precisely the function of a radiant barrier. This post aims to simplify and elucidate the science behind radiant barrier foil insulation.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eTo grasp the mechanism of a radiant barrier, it's essential to comprehend the three primary modes of heat transfer: conduction, convection, and radiation.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eConduction involves the direct flow of heat through a solid object, such as a wall or ceiling.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eConvection refers to heat movement through the air, occurring as warmed air expands, becoming less dense and rising.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eRadiant heat involves the transfer of heat rays across air spaces from one warm object to another cooler object. An example of radiant heat is the warmth felt from a campfire, representing the most dominant form of heat transfer.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eWhile various types of heat contribute to heat transfer in and out of your home, radiant heat constitutes the largest percentage of heat loss or gain, regardless of the climate or season, making it the predominant contributor.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eConventional insulation materials like fiberglass, cellulose, and foam primarily function to absorb and slow down conductive and convective heat. They absorb heat akin to how a sponge absorbs water. However, as insulation becomes saturated with heat, its efficiency diminishes. In contrast, radiant barrier foil insulation reflects 95% of radiant heat, effectively blocking it instead of absorbing it like other insulation materials.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e remarkable efficacy of radiant barrier foil insulation in blocking radiant heat stems from its exceptionally low emissivity rate. Emissivity denotes a material's ability to emit radiant energy. Common building materials like brick, stone, and wood exhibit high emissivity rates, absorbing substantial amounts of radiant energy and emitting a significant portion of this energy to the surrounding spaces. Radiant barrier foil insulation, with its low emissivity rate of 3% to 5%, absorbs and emits minimal energy, allowing radiant heat to pass through at a significantly slower rate compared to traditional materials.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eBelow is a table comparing the emissivity rates of common building materials to those of radiant barrier foil insulation.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cdiv\u003e\u003ccenter\u003e\n\u003ctable\u003e\n\u003c!--StartFragment--\u003e\u003ccolgroup\u003e \u003ccol\u003e \u003ccol\u003e \u003c\/colgroup\u003e\n\u003ctbody\u003e\n\u003ctr\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003eMATERIAL\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003eEMISSIVITY\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n\u003ctr\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003eWood\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e95%\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n\u003ctr\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003eGlass\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e94%\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n\u003ctr\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003eBrick (common red)\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e93%\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n\u003ctr\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003eConcrete\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e92%\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n\u003ctr\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003eSteel\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e45%\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n\u003ctr\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003eRadiant Barrier (Aluminum)\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e3-5%\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n\u003c!--EndFragment--\u003e\n\u003c\/tbody\u003e\n\u003c\/table\u003e\n\u003c\/center\u003e\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eAlso, radiant barrier insulation will never need to be replaced. It is made up of coated aluminum, so it will never break down due to UV or corrosion. Other insulations rely on their mass to remain effective, meaning that as they settle and flatten, they become much less efficient and need to be replaced. A radiant barrier doesn’t settle or flatten the way other insulation can and doesn’t rely on thickness or mass to work. Radiant barriers can provide a lifetime of energy-saving benefits.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003ch2\u003e\u003cb\u003e\u003cspan\u003eThe Benefits of Radiant It is made with a patent-pending, polypropylene-based, non-woven, perforated fabric with aluminum on one side. The reflective aluminum film is a very thin coating that has tiny pinholes to allow it to breathe so it won't trap moisture. Because of this, the fabric is not waterproof, and it is not designed to be exposed to the elements, but rather to be an integral part of your heat shield or reflective barrier system.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eIt reflects 95% of the radiant heat, the major source of heat transfer, and with this technology, it will retain or reflect heat, thereby remaining warmer or cooler as desired. It may be washed by hand or machine-washed with a gentle cycle and is easily used in traditional sewing machines. It will work wonderfully in a tent, but it is applied on the interior with the aluminum side facing out. That allows it to block the incoming radiant heat and will not allow the heat striking the tent to emit downward into the air space below.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eOther fabrics only absorb heat, delaying it before it reaches you. Temptrol is the only fabric that acts as a radiant barrier to reflect heat. Each standard roll is 59\" wide and is available in any custom length when ordered in lengths over 20 yards.
